引言
随着互联网技术的不断发展,Web前端框架已经成为现代Web开发的重要组成部分。掌握Web前端框架,可以帮助开发者提高开发效率,构建更加复杂和功能丰富的Web应用。本文将为您介绍掌握Web前端框架的简单几步,帮助您快速入门。
第一步:掌握基础技术
在开始学习Web前端框架之前,您需要掌握以下基础技术:
HTML
HTML(超文本标记语言)是构建Web页面的骨架。学习HTML时,首先要了解基本的标签和结构,如<html>
, <head>
, <body>
, <div>
, <span>
等。掌握这些基础知识后,可以进一步学习表单元素、表格以及HTML5新特性,如<canvas>
, <video>
等。
CSS
CSS(层叠样式表)用于控制页面的布局和样式。初学者需要掌握选择器、盒模型、定位、浮动、Flexbox和Grid等基础知识。通过实践,逐步提高对复杂布局和响应式设计的理解。
JavaScript
JavaScript是Web开发的核心语言,用于实现页面的动态效果和交互功能。学习JavaScript时,应该重点掌握变量、数据类型、函数、事件、DOM操作和异步编程等基础知识。通过实践项目,如制作一个简单的网页应用,能够更好地理解和应用所学知识。
第二步:选择合适的框架
选择一个适合自己的Web前端框架对于学习过程至关重要。以下是一些流行的Web前端框架:
Bootstrap
Bootstrap是一个流行的前端UI框架,它提供了丰富的组件和响应式设计能力。它的优点是易于上手,文档详细,社区资源丰富。
React
React是由Facebook开发的一个用于构建用户界面的JavaScript库。它具有虚拟DOM(Document Object Model)渲染,可以提供高性能的用户体验。
Angular
Angular是由Google开发的一个全栈JavaScript框架。它提供了强大的模块化和依赖注入支持,适合开发大型应用。
Vue
Vue是一个渐进式JavaScript框架,易于上手,具有响应式和组件化的特点。它适用于构建各种规模的应用。
第三步:深入学习框架文档
选择一个框架后,阅读官方文档和教程是非常重要的。官方文档和教程提供了基础知识和最佳实践,帮助您快速掌握框架的使用。
第四步:实践项目
通过实践项目,能够更好地理解和应用所学知识。以下是一些建议的实践项目:
制作个人博客
通过制作个人博客,您可以学习如何使用框架创建响应式布局,实现表单验证、文章发布等功能。
开发在线商店
开发在线商店可以帮助您学习如何使用框架实现商品展示、购物车、订单管理等功能。
制作社交应用
制作社交应用可以学习如何使用框架实现用户注册、登录、消息推送等功能。
第五步:关注社区和更新
关注社区和版本更新,可以及时了解最新的技术动态和解决方案。加入相关论坛、微信群等,与其他开发者交流心得,共同进步。
总结
掌握Web前端框架并非难事,只需按照以上步骤,不断学习和实践,相信您一定能够成为一名优秀的Web前端开发者。祝您学习顺利!